Are you still holding onto pain because you secretly want revenge, thinking it will set you free?
Recently, I watched a video of a woman who had been deeply hurt. She said she didn’t want to heal, because if she healed, she wouldn’t be able to take revenge.
Many people feel the same way. They hold onto pain thinking revenge will make them feel better. But in the process, they stay stuck. Because they haven’t healed, the smallest thing triggers them, and sometimes they bleed on innocent people.
I remember being there myself. I justified my anger and thought revenge would bring relief. But when I finally chose healing, everything changed. I started smiling genuinely again. The way I parented my children in my hopefororphansUganda family changed. My work changed. I realized the real enemy wasn’t the person who hurt me; it was me, holding onto the pain.
If you’re tired of going in circles, tired of carrying pain that steals your peace, I want you to know you don’t have to walk this road alone. I’m here to hold your hand and guide you to healing. Good morning everyone.

Hey,have you been rejected before? How did it feel? For how long did you ponder why people are so cruel and treat others like trash? How did you react to rejection?

Well,Rejection is something that happens to all of us and yes,it's a normal reaction when we aren't accepted in someway but do you know that there is a group of people who take rejection as an opportunity to learn and grow as well as another group that takes rejection personal? The later gets upset, angry and so sad when rejected to the extent that it affects their daily life. This will lead them to avoiding social activities because they anticipate rejection all the time. But look,these individuals don't actually do that on purpose,we must understand that then we can be able to lean in when they are experiencing those strong emotions,its just that their emotional response is higher than the rest of the people so,how does that come about? Why is it that some people react so strongly to rejection and others don't?

We must be asking ourselves questions like; What is rejection and why does it hurt so much? what emotions do such Individuals experience during rejection? How can we be kind to ourselves and others experiencing rejection? What words of comfort and encouragement can we speak to an individual experiencing rejection? How can we turn rejection into a positive learning opportunity?
How can we manage not to take rejection personal?
